The Strategic Program Manager, Global Marketing Planning & Operations will work within eBay’s Global Marketing organization, partnering closely with marketing leadership, business collaborators, and cross-functional teams to guide the full process of complex, integrated global marketing programs. This role is responsible for turning approved marketing plans into clear program and project plans, guaranteeing seamless coordination, timely completion, and excellent execution across channels and regions.

You will collaborate with global brand, marketing operations, CRM, product marketing, media, communications, consumer insights, creative teams, and agency partners to manage campaign lifecycles from kickoff through delivery, optimization, and post-campaign review. The Strategic Program Manager will hold a meaningful role in connecting teams, coordinating timelines, and maintaining operational rigor to support eBay’s business and brand objectives.

What you will accomplish:
  • Manage the planning, development, and execution of global marketing programs and campaigns across priority marketing initiatives

  • Partner with cross-functional stakeholders to align marketing objectives, customer strategies, and go-to-market execution plans

  • Own end-to-end campaign program management, including scope definition, timelines, resource coordination, and milestone tracking

  • Support integrated omni-channel marketing delivery across paid and owned channels, partnering with creative, media, and agency teams from concept through optimization

  • Coordinate creative development and production workflows, including collaboration with internal creative teams and external agency partners

  • Build and manage detailed project plans, identify dependencies and risks, and ensure deliverables are completed on time and to quality standards

  • Facilitate stakeholder alignment by managing approvals, sign-offs, and ongoing communication with marketing and business partners

  • Provide regular status updates, reporting, and visibility into program progress, risks, and timelines

  • Develop and maintain clear operating processes, documentation, and RASCIs to support efficient campaign execution

  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and operational efficiency within global marketing workflows

What you will bring:
  • Experience in marketing program management, project management, or agency account management

  • Strong understanding of digital marketing and integrated campaign execution across multiple channels

  • Proven experience working with creative teams and managing creative development processes

  • Ability to manage multiple workstreams in a fast-paced, matrixed, and collaborative environment

  • Strong communication, organizational, and stakeholder management skills

The base pay range for this position is expected in the range below:

C$85,600 - C$114,300

Base pay offered may vary depending on multiple individualized factors, including location, skills, and experience. The total compensation package for this position may also include other elements, including a target bonus and restricted stock units (as applicable) in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its (including RRSP eligibility, various paid time off benefits, such as PTO and parental leave). What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
